Insulin, Fasting
Test Code3965
Alias/See Also
Insulin
Preferred Specimen
One 4 mL serum separator tube. Also acceptable: lavender (EDTA) or pink (K2EDTA).
Minimum Volume
1 mL serum or plasma, frozen. (Min 0.5 mL) Submit specimen in an ARUP Standard Transport Tube.
Transport Temperature
1 mL serum or plasma, frozen. (Min 0.5 mL) Submit specimen in an ARUP Standard Transport Tube.
Specimen Stability
After separation from cells: Ambient: 8 hours; Refrigerated: 1 week; Frozen: 1 month
Reject Criteria (Eg, hemolysis? Lipemia? Thaw/Other?)
Heparinized plasma, vitreous and I.V. fluids. Specimens collected in gray (sodium fluoride/potassium oxalate). Hemolyzed specimens.
Methodology
Chemiluminescent Immunoassay
Setup Schedule
Sun-Sat
Report Available
Within 24 hours
Limitations
Allow serum to clot completely at room temperature. Separate serum or plasma from cells ASAP.
Clinical Significance
This assay reacts on a nearly equimolar basis with insulin aspart, insulin glargine, and insulin lispro. To convert to pmol/L, multiply µIU/mL by 6.0.
